Monster-in-Law returns as TV series

Monster-in-Law
TV series based on popular romantic comedy Monster-In-Law is in works. According to a report in Deadline.com, the “Carrie Diaries” developer and executive producer Amy B. Harris and “30 Rock” executive producer John Riggi are making the show, reports contactmusic.com The multi-camera comedy will be a follow-up to the big screen version and the film's producers Chris Bender and J.C. Spink will also serve as executive producers with Harris and Riggi. The 2005 movie was a huge hit, grossing $154.7 million at the worldwide box office. (Source: IANS)
